God's Amazing Gifts


Be quick to give a meal to the hungry, a bed to the homeless—cheerfully. Be generous with the different things God gave you, passing them around so all get in on it: if words, let it be God's words; if help, let it be God's hearty help. That way, God's bright presence will be evident in everything through Jesus, and he'll get all the credit as the One mighty in everything—encores to the end of time.
 - 1 Peter 4:10 (The Message)

Right now I am at work at the Mark Twain Study sitting on the front steps with the sun shining down on me through the trees and I can’t help but to feel thankful.
This morning at church I had an unshakeable feeling of uncertainty. During prayer I just kept asking God for a sign. “I need guidance Lord; I need You to show me where to go and what to do with my life”. I needed to hear God’s voice. I needed Him to point me in the right direction. I needed to know that I am making Him proud by the way I am living. God did not shout down from Heaven or place an iridescent arrow in front of me pointing me in the right direction. Instead He showed me the way through the love and understanding of a friend.

My amazing friend Heather and I... we are proud and beautfiul women of God!

On the ride home from church I told one of my best friends about the uncertainty I was feeling. To my surprise, she said she felt the same way sometimes! Now this friend is one of the strongest Christian women I know. She is the kind of woman I aspire to be like, so full of faith and living every day for God. Right then, in the car I believe that God worked through her to give me what I needed the most: someone to listen and understand. I didn’t need all of life’s answers right then, I just needed someone to reassure me that I’m not alone and that I am doing God’s will.
Flash forward to now. I’m sitting outside just reflecting on all the wonderful things God has made and all for a purpose. Now more than ever I know I have a purpose too. Deep down in my heart I know God has given me the gift of serving others. I have always loved doing community service and helping others in any way I can. God has filled my heart with the need to serve and I know that by doing that I am going in the right direction and fulfilling my Heavenly Father’s will for my life.
